Output 2e504166f727940c04397d889f188e4c24222dada6fb6157afc909130035239e:6

value
138089678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e87f9bab587ff051f7df6ae34397ac0bb423996 OP_EQUAL
address
MKSCGLwL1A4kP4EBphKGApWkqpqA9qFABs
transaction
2e504166f727940c04397d889f188e4c24222dada6fb6157afc909130035239e
spent
true